Visual thinkers are often overlooked, and educational systems fail to support them. In Visual Thinking (2022), autism spokesperson and animal behaviorist Temple Grandin examines the unique capabilities of visual thinkers and advocates for the inclusion of people with diverse cognitive abilities in education and the workforce. Drawing on cutting-edge research, Grandin explores the different types of visual thinking, shedding light on the intersection of neurodiversity, genius, and visual thinking.
